Q.

The coefficient of volume expansion of glycerine is 49 x 10-5/0C. What is the fractional change in its density (approx.) for 30°C rise in temperature?

Detailed Solution

detailed_solution_thumbnail

Coefficient of volume expansion of glycerine.
γ= 49×10-5/ 0C
Rise in temperature, T = 30°C

As γ = 1T(VV)  VV = γ×T

or VV = (49×10-5)×30 = 0.0147

Since mass remains constant,
Fractional change in density = fractional change in volume = 0.0147 = 1.5 x 10-2
